I invite you today to take a few moments to enjoy a concert of scripture. Here are several verses which make up the foundation of Insignia’s ministry style, presented without references or explanations. I encourage you to try to hear them afresh. Please read slowly, and take a breath between each one!


· “He who began a good work in you will perfect it until the Day of Christ.”


· “Walk in wisdom towards those who are outside…”


· “Christ in you, the Hope of Glory…”


· “We were well-pleased to impart not only the gospel but our very lives, because you had become so dear to us.”


· “You are the salt of the earth, the light of the world.”


· “They’ll know you are my disciples, by your love for one another.”


· “Love your neighbor as yourself…”


· “You shall be My witnesses both in Jerusalem, and in all Judea and Samaria, and even to the remotest part of the earth.”

· “This mystery has been kept in the dark for a long time, but now it’s out in the open. God wanted everyone to know this rich and glorious secret inside and out, regardless of their background, regardless of their religious standing. The mystery in a nutshell is just this: Christ is in you, so therefore you can look forward to sharing in God’s glory. It’s that simple…To be mature is to be basic. Christ! No more, no less. That’s what I’m working so hard at, day after day, year after year, doing my best with the energy God so generously gives me.”


· "Faith is the assurance of things hoped for, the conviction of things not seen.”


How was that? Yes, these verses are drawn from various Bible translations. Perhaps you recognized some? Were a few of them new to you? …It’s different, isn’t it, to hear the scriptures without additional prose or commentary? And without the chapter and verse references? That is how the early saints heard them originally, long before the headings and organizational chapters and verses were added for reference purposes. Were you able to connect the methodologies and practices you’ve seen in our ministries with what you have just read?


I encourage you to reflect on these from time to time. For all that we do to help our ministry events feel natural, casual, and somewhat spontaneous, there is quite a bit of Biblical foundation to almost every little component and detail.
